A SERVICE OF

logo

www.ti.com
5.50.31TransmitandReceive512to1023OctetFramesRegister(FRAME512T1023)
5.50.32TransmitandReceive1024toRXMAXLENOctetFramesRegister(FRAME1024TUP)
5.50.33NetworkOctetFramesRegister(NETOCTETS)
5.50.34ReceiveFIFOorDMAStartofFrameOverrunsRegister(RXSOFOVERRUNS)
EthernetMediaAccessController(EMAC)Registers
Thetotalnumberof512-byteto1023-byteframesreceivedandtransmittedontheEMAC.Sucha
frameisdefinedashavingallofthefollowing:
AnydataorMACcontrolframethatwasdestinedforanyunicast,broadcast,ormulticastaddress
Didnotexperiencelatecollisions,excessivecollisions,underrun,orcarriersenseerror
Was512-bytesto1023-byteslong
CRCerrors,alignment/codeerrors,andoverrunsdonotaffecttherecordingofframesinthisstatistic.
Thetotalnumberof1024-bytetoRXMAXLEN-byteframesreceivedandtransmittedontheEMAC.
Suchaframeisdefinedashavingallofthefollowing:
AnydataorMACcontrolframethatwasdestinedforanyunicast,broadcast,ormulticastaddress
Didnotexperiencelatecollisions,excessivecollisions,underrun,orcarriersenseerror
Was1024-bytestoRXMAXLEN-byteslong
CRC/alignment/codeerrors,underruns,andoverrunsdonotaffectframerecordinginthisstatistic.
ThetotalnumberofbytesofframedatareceivedandtransmittedontheEMAC.Eachframecounted
hasallofthefollowing:
WasanydataorMACcontrolframedestinedforanyunicast,broadcast,ormulticastaddress
(addressmatchdoesnotmatter)
Wasofanysize(includinglessthan64-byteandgreaterthanRXMAXLEN-byteframes)
Alsocountedinthisstatisticis:
Everybytetransmittedbeforeacarrier-losswasexperienced
Everybytetransmittedbeforeeachcollisionwasexperienced(multipleretriesarecountedeach
time)
EverybytereceivediftheEMACisinhalf-duplexmodeuntilajamsequencewastransmittedto
initiateflowcontrol.(Thejamsequenceisnotcountedtopreventdouble-counting).
Errorconditionssuchasalignmenterrors,CRCerrors,codeerrors,overruns,andunderrunsdonot
affecttherecordingofbytesinthisstatistic.Theobjectiveofthisstatisticistogiveareasonable
indicationofEthernetutilization.
ThetotalnumberofframesreceivedontheEMACthathadeitheraFIFOorDMAstartofframe(SOF)
overrun.AnSOFoverrunframeisdefinedashavingallofthefollowing:
WasanydataorMACcontrolframethatmatchedaunicast,broadcast,ormulticastaddress,or
matchedduetopromiscuousmode
Wasofanysize(includinglessthan64-byteandgreaterthanRXMAXLEN-byteframes)
TheEMACwasunabletoreceiveitbecauseitdidnothavetheresourcestoreceiveit(cellFIFOfull
ornoDMAbufferavailableatthestartoftheframe).
CRCerrors,alignmenterrors,andcodeerrorshavenoeffectonthisstatistic.
SPRUEQ6December2007EthernetMediaAccessController(EMAC)/ManagementDataInput/Output(MDIO)131
SubmitDocumentationFeedback